(* Size Groups * * GtkSizeGroup provides a mechanism for grouping a number of * widgets together so they all request the same amount of space. * This is typically useful when you want a column of widgets to * have the same size, but you can't use a GtkTable widget. * * Note that size groups only affect the amount of space requested, * not the size that the widgets finally receive. If you want the * widgets in a GtkSizeGroup to actually be the same size, you need * to pack them in such a way that they get the size they request * and not more. For example, if you are packing your widgets * into a table, you would not include the GTK_FILL flag. *) var sg_window : PGtkWidget; const color_options : array [0..3] of pchar = ('Red', 'Green', 'Blue', NULL); dash_options : array [0..3] of pchar = ('Solid', 'Dashed', 'Dotted', NULL); end_options : array [0..3] of pchar = ('Square', 'Round', 'Arrow', NULL); (* Convenience function to create an option menu holding a number of strings *) function create_option_menu (strings : ppchar): PGtkWidget; var menu, menu_item, option_menu : PGtkWidget; str : ppchar; begin menu := gtk_menu_new (); str := strings; while str^ <> NULL do begin menu_item := gtk_menu_item_new_with_label ( str[0]); gtk_widget_show (menu_item); gtk_menu_shell_append (pGtkMenuShell(menu), menu_item); inc(str); end; option_menu := gtk_option_menu_new (); gtk_option_menu_set_menu (pGtkOptionMenu(option_menu), menu); create_option_menu := option_menu; end; procedure add_row (table : PGtkTable; row : integer; size_group : PGtkSizeGroup; label_text : pchar; options : ppchar); var option_menu : PGtkWidget; thelabel : PGtkWidget; begin thelabel := gtk_label_new_with_mnemonic (label_text); gtk_misc_set_alignment (pGtkMisc(thelabel), 0, 1); gtk_table_attach (pGtkTable(table), thelabel, 0, 1, row, row + 1, GTK_EXPAND or GTK_FILL, 0, 0, 0); option_menu := create_option_menu (options); gtk_label_set_mnemonic_widget (pGtkLabel(thelabel), option_menu); gtk_size_group_add_widget (size_group, option_menu); gtk_table_attach (pGtkTable(table), option_menu, 1, 2, row, row + 1, 0, 0, 0, 0); end; procedure toggle_grouping (check_button : PGtkToggleButton; size_group : PGtkSizeGroup); cdecl; var new_mode : TGtkSizeGroupMode; begin (* GTK_SIZE_GROUP_NONE is not generally useful, but is useful * here to show the effect of GTK_SIZE_GROUP_HORIZONTAL by * contrast. *) if gtk_toggle_button_get_active (check_button) then new_mode := GTK_SIZE_GROUP_HORIZONTAL else new_mode := GTK_SIZE_GROUP_NONE; gtk_size_group_set_mode (size_group, new_mode); end; function do_sizegroup : PGtkWidget; var table, frame, vbox, check_button : PGtkWidget; size_group : PGtkSizeGroup; begin if sg_window = NULL then begin sg_window := gtk_dialog_new_with_buttons ('Size Groups', NULL, 0, GTK_STOCK_CLOSE, [ GTK_RESPONSE_NONE, NULL]); gtk_window_set_resizable (pGtkWindow(sg_window), FALSE); g_signal_connect (sg_window, 'response', TGCallback(@gtk_widget_destroy), NULL); g_signal_connect (sg_window, 'destroy', TGCallback(@gtk_widget_destroyed), @sg_window); vbox := gtk_vbox_new (FALSE, 5); gtk_box_pack_start (pGtkBox(pGtkDialog (sg_window)^.vbox), vbox, TRUE, TRUE, 0); gtk_container_set_border_width (pGtkContainer(vbox), 5); size_group := gtk_size_group_new (GTK_SIZE_GROUP_HORIZONTAL); (* Create one frame holding color options *) frame := gtk_frame_new ('Color Options'); gtk_box_pack_start (pGtkBox(vbox), frame, TRUE, TRUE, 0); table := gtk_table_new (2, 2, FALSE); gtk_container_set_border_width (pGtkContainer(table), 5); gtk_table_set_row_spacings (pGtkTable(table), 5); gtk_table_set_col_spacings (pGtkTable(table), 10); gtk_container_add (pGtkContainer(frame), table); add_row (pGtkTable(table), 0, size_group, '_Foreground', @color_options[0]); add_row (pGtkTable(table), 1, size_group, '_Background', @color_options[0]); (* And another frame holding line style options *) frame := gtk_frame_new ('Line Options'); gtk_box_pack_start (pGtkBox(vbox), frame, FALSE, FALSE, 0); table := gtk_table_new (2, 2, FALSE); gtk_container_set_border_width (pGtkContainer(table), 5); gtk_table_set_row_spacings (pGtkTable(table), 5); gtk_table_set_col_spacings (pGtkTable(table), 10); gtk_container_add (pGtkContainer(frame), table); add_row (pGtkTable(table), 0, size_group, '_Dashing', @dash_options[0]); add_row (pGtkTable(table), 1, size_group, '_Line ends', @end_options[0]); (* And a check button to turn grouping on and off *) check_button := gtk_check_button_new_with_mnemonic ('_Enable grouping'); gtk_box_pack_start (pGtkBox(vbox), check_button, FALSE, FALSE, 0); gtk_toggle_button_set_active (pGtkToggleButton(check_button), TRUE); g_signal_connect (check_button, 'toggled', TGCallback (@toggle_grouping), size_group); end; if not GTK_WIDGET_VISIBLE (sg_window) then gtk_widget_show_all (sg_window) else begin gtk_widget_destroy (sg_window); sg_window := NULL; end; do_sizegroup := sg_window; end;
